John Martin

Prospect-John T. Martin, 60, passed away on Thursday, April 7, 2011 at Yale New Haven Hospital surrounded by his loving family. He was the husband of Carol A. (Clark) Martin .

Mr. Martin was born on June 16, 1950 in Providence, RI a son of the late Raymond and Virginia (Gannon) Martin. He worked as a cable splicer for SNET for many years. He was a member of the ELKS Lodge in Naugatuck, the Prospect Senior Center, the Prospect Gun Club and the Saturday morning Boys Breakfast Club. He was a US Navy Veteran having served during the Vietnam era.

Besides his loving wife of Prospect he is survived by two daughters, Nikki Martin and her life partner Paula Burofsky of Deltona, FL and Lindsey Tucker and her husband JT of DeBary, FL, one son, Michael DeCosa of Naugatuck, one sister, Renee Martin of Danbury, two brothers, Tim Martin and his wife Thea of New Fairfield, Daniel Martin and several nieces and nephews. His is also survived by his golden retriever Kobe.

Funeral services will be held on Sunday, April 10, 2011 at 4:00 p.m. at the Buckmiller Brothers Funeral Home, 26 Waterbury Rd, Rte 69, Prospect. Burial will be private and held at a later date. Friends may call at the funeral home on Sunday afternoon from 2-4 p.m.

Memorial Contributions may be made to: Smilow Cancer Hospital, PO Box 1849, New Haven, CT 06508.
